General Summary:

  • The Clinical Speech-Language Pathologist is responsible for conducting diagnostic treatment and counseling activities for out-patients and for in-patients at Sibley Memorial Hospital. These duties also include providing professional guidance to hospital staff for communicatively handicapped patients.

Minimum Qualifications:

  • Master’s Degree in Speech-Language Pathology.
  • Must have at least one year experience in an acute care facility to include: dysphagia, aphasia, and videofluroscopy.
  • DC License required.
  • Current CPR Certification required.
  • Certificate of Clinical Competence (CCCs).

Shifts:

  • Two weekend shifts per month required

Salary Range: Minimum $60.00/hour - Maximum $60.00/hour. Compensation will be commensurate with equity and experience for roles of similar scope and responsibility.
